It's the Supreme Court, Stupid
--Headline in New York's Village Voice (8/30/2000)
By the end of the next President's term, six of the current members of the Court will be over 70 years of age. The average age of retirement over the past century has been 71--and so we are likely in for an unprecedented wave of retirements. It is entirely possible that whoever is elected next Novemmber will have the power to appoint a new majority of the members of the Supreme Court.
As president, I will only appoint Supreme Court Justices who will uphold a woman's right to choose.
--pro-abortion presidential candidate John Kerry (10/3/03 & 3/8/04)
Because a caring society will value its weakest members, we must make a place for the unborn child. And I will continue to appoint federal judges who know the difference between personal opinion and the strict interpretation of the law.
--President George W. Bush (9/2/04)
